当前位置: 首页 > news >正文

避坑指南:HA添加小米设备总提示‘没有设备’?可能是你的小米账号权限不对

智能家居避坑指南:解决HA添加小米设备时"没有设备"的权限陷阱

当你满怀期待地准备将心爱的小米智能设备接入Home Assistant(HA),却在登录小米账号后遭遇冰冷的"该小米账号下没有设备"提示时,那种挫败感我深有体会。这不是简单的操作失误,而是一个隐藏极深的权限陷阱——你的小米账号可能只是家庭"共享成员"而非"创建者"。本文将带你深入剖析这一问题的根源,并提供一套完整的解决方案。

1. 权限问题的本质:家庭创建者与共享成员的区别

小米智能家居生态采用了一种独特的权限管理体系,这与我们日常使用的社交账号或云服务有着本质区别。在米家App中,家庭创建者拥有设备管理的最高权限,而共享成员则只能控制设备,无法进行设备添加或删除等核心操作。

关键差异对比

权限类型设备添加设备删除家庭成员管理HA集成支持
家庭创建者
家庭共享成员

这种现象背后的逻辑其实很合理:小米希望确保家庭智能设备的管理权掌握在主要家庭成员手中,避免随意添加或删除设备造成的混乱。但这一设计在HA集成场景下却成为了一个隐蔽的绊脚石。

提示:即使你是家庭的实际创建者,如果当前登录的是共享成员账号,HA同样会显示"没有设备"。务必确认登录的是创建者账号。

2. 四步诊断法:确认你的账号权限状态

在开始任何修复操作前,我们需要准确诊断问题根源。以下是经过验证的四步诊断流程:

  1. 米家App检查

    • 打开米家App,进入"我的"→"家庭管理"
    • 查看当前账号旁是否显示"创建者"标识
    • 如果没有此标识,说明你当前使用的是共享成员账号
  2. 设备可见性验证

    • 在米家App主页,确认你能看到所有预期接入HA的设备
    • 尝试长按某个设备,检查是否出现"删除"选项(创建者才有此权限)
  3. 多账号排查

    • 回忆你是否使用过不同手机号或邮箱注册过小米账号
    • 很多用户实际上拥有多个小米账号而不自知
  4. 家庭切换测试

    • 如果你管理多个家庭,确保在米家App中选择了正确的家庭
    • 每个家庭可能有不同的创建者账号
# 伪代码:账号权限诊断流程 def diagnose_account_permission(): if 米家App显示"创建者"标识: return "具备足够权限" elif 能看到设备但无法删除: return "共享成员账号" else: return "可能登录了错误账号或未绑定设备"

3. 解决方案:从账号切换到HA配置的完整流程

一旦确认权限问题,以下是经过实战检验的解决步骤:

3.1 获取正确的家庭创建者账号

  1. 联系家庭创建者

    • 如果是家人创建的智能家庭,请其分享创建者账号
    • 注意:只需账号密码,不需要转让家庭创建者身份
  2. 创建新家庭(若无权访问原创建者账号):

    • 在米家App中新建一个家庭
    • 将所有设备重新绑定到新家庭
    • 此方法需要重新配置所有自动化场景

3.2 米家App中的关键设置

  • 设备迁移步骤

    1. 使用创建者账号登录米家App
    2. 进入"我的"→"家庭管理"
    3. 选择"共享家庭",移除旧的共享成员账号
    4. 重新共享家庭给需要的成员
  • 权限验证技巧

    • 创建者账号登录后,检查"设备共享"选项
    • 确保"允许控制"和"允许查看"权限已开启

3.3 HA中的Xiaomi Miot Auto集成配置

  1. 清理旧配置

    • 进入HA的"配置"→"集成"
    • 删除所有与小米相关的集成
  2. 重新添加集成

    # configuration.yaml示例(可选) xiaomi_miot: username: 创建者账号 password: 密码 server_country: 'cn' # 根据地区调整
  3. 设备筛选技巧

    • 在集成配置页面,使用"筛选设备"功能
    • 按房间或类型筛选,避免一次性加载过多设备

4. 其他可能导致"没有设备"的常见原因及排查

虽然账号权限是主因,但其他因素也可能导致类似现象。以下是完整的排查清单:

  • 网络隔离问题

    • 确保HA主机和小米设备在同一局域网
    • 检查路由器设置,确保没有启用AP隔离
  • 插件版本过旧

    • 通过HACS检查Xiaomi Miot Auto是否为最新版
    • 更新命令:
      wget -q -O - https://ghproxy.com/raw.githubusercontent.com/al-one/hass-xiaomi-miot/master/install.sh | HUB_DOMAIN=ghproxy.com/github.com ARCHIVE_TAG=latest bash -
  • 区域限制

    • 某些小米设备仅限中国大陆使用
    • 尝试在集成配置中将服务器地区改为'cn'
  • 设备类型限制

    • 不是所有小米/米家设备都支持MIoT协议
    • 检查设备是否在官方支持列表中

5. 高级技巧:多账号管理与自动化优化

对于拥有多个小米账号或复杂家庭场景的用户,这些技巧能提升使用体验:

多账号切换方案

  1. 使用HA的多个集成实例

    • 为每个小米账号创建独立的Xiaomi Miot Auto集成
    • 通过命名区分不同账号的设备
  2. 自动化账号切换

    # 示例自动化:根据时间自动切换活跃账号 automation: - alias: "夜间使用备用小米账号" trigger: - platform: time at: "22:00:00" action: - service: xiaomi_miot.set_account data: account: "夜间账号"

性能优化建议

  • 对于设备数量多的家庭,启用集成配置中的"异步加载"选项
  • 定期清理不使用的设备实体,减少HA负载
  • 考虑按房间分批加载设备,而非一次性加载全部

6. 预防措施与最佳实践

为了避免未来再次遇到类似问题,建议建立以下规范:

  • 账号管理纪律

    • 指定一个专用邮箱/手机号作为智能家居创建者账号
    • 将该账号凭证安全存储在密码管理器中
  • 定期检查清单

    • 每月验证一次米家App中的家庭权限状态
    • 在添加新成员时,明确权限需求
  • 文档记录

    • 维护一份智能家居设备与账号的对应表
    • 记录重要设备的绑定时间和配置参数

在实际部署中,我发现最稳妥的做法是创建一个专门用于智能家居管理的小米账号,不与个人日常账号混用。这样既能确保权限稳定,又能避免因人员变动导致的访问问题。

http://www.jsqmd.com/news/704089/

相关文章:

  • 终极指南:10分钟搞定kohya_ss AI训练环境,零基础也能玩转Stable Diffusion!
  • 分享2篇最新Harness论文,一篇谷歌,一篇微软
  • 避坑指南:Qt QTableView冻结行列时,你可能遇到的5个诡异Bug及解决方法
  • 元学习:让AI快速掌握新任务的机器学习方法
  • 康复机器人开发笔记:用TwinCAT3和EtherCAT搞定无框力矩电机的第一步
  • 7种高级NLP特征工程技巧提升LLM嵌入效果
  • BERT模型解析:原理、变种与工业应用指南
  • Python 异步文件操作实践
  • gte-base-zh应用解析:在新闻聚合平台中实现内容去重
  • STC15单片机定时器不够用?实战解析蓝桥杯决赛中超声波与NE555的定时器分配策略
  • Snap.Hutao原神工具箱:用开源技术重新定义Windows平台游戏体验
  • Visual C++运行库终极解决方案:一键修复所有Windows软件兼容性问题
  • 从手动F5到全自动智能交付:VS Code Copilot Next 工作流配置进阶路径图(含6阶段能力评估矩阵)
  • Rust 性能优化的五个技巧
  • 2026届毕业生推荐的六大AI辅助写作网站实测分析
  • 如何快速掌握猫抓资源嗅探:技术爱好者的完整实战指南
  • 汽车诊断系统:故障代码读取与维修建议
  • 从ZLToolKit的线程池看C++11/14并发编程:semaphore、thread_group与模板技巧详解
  • 终极窗口调整指南:用WindowResizer强制改变任意窗口尺寸的完整教程
  • 3分钟掌握手机号码精准定位:location-to-phone-number开源工具完全指南
  • BetterNCM Installer:如何用Rust重构网易云插件管理生态?
  • 2026年新生如何集成OpenClaw/Hermes Agent?教程呈现
  • Qt国际化完全指南:从源码机制到工程实践
  • RuoYi AI 开源全栈式 AI 开发平台,为客服团队打造一个企业级私有化智能问答助手(一)
  • 3大YOLOv11多光谱目标检测实战痛点诊断与修复指南
  • 【MCP 2026边缘资源管理白皮书首发】:覆盖98.3%异构硬件的轻量级Agent协议栈设计实录
  • Neovim AI编程插件CodeCompanion.nvim:从适配器架构到实战配置
  • AI智能体自我进化框架:从静态执行到动态优化的工程实践
  • KDDockWidgets深度解析:Qt停靠布局的工业级解决方案
  • 深圳首推门店核心竞争力综合解析,品牌、技术、服务、口碑多维优势综述 - Reaihenh